Hello everyone,

 

Is it possible to edit AutoCAD drawings in A360 and also will it be possible to run Alisp/Vlisp files sometime in the future?.

 

Thanks,

 

AloyH

Solved! by bud.schroeder. See the answer in context.

Kudo

Hello Aloy,

 

Thanks for posting your question to the fourm. A360 is not an editor, it is a collaboration tool. You will need AutoCAD, AutoCAD LT, an AutoCAD based vertical, or AutoCAD 360 Pro to edit your drawings.
